Forestry specialists are conducting explanatory work among the population about the peculiarities of the regime introduced in the Republic of Tatarstan to restrict the stay of citizens in forests and the entry of vehicles into them. “We are distributing information leaflets, informing citizens about the operation of the regime and reminding them about the rules of fire safety in forests, - said Ilnar Akhmetgaliev, head of the GKU RT Menzelinsky forestry. - In addition, the around-the-clock watch has been organized, and patrolling in forest areas has been strengthened to prevent the occurrence of forest fires.”
Recall that the Resolution of the Cabinet of Ministers of the Republic of Tatarstan dated 12.05.2021 No. 329 in the Republic of Tatarstan restricted the stay of citizens in forests and the entry of vehicles into them from May 14 to 21 calendar days. Restrictions are established with forests located on the lands of the forest fund of the republic.
According to the decree, specialists of the subordinate institutions of the Ministry of Forestry of the Republic of Tatarstan carried out work on the installation of warning notices about the introduction of a restriction and the period of its validity and the blocking of forest roads with barriers.
Fire safety in the forest in the Republic of Tatarstan is provided by 20 types II forest fire stations and 5 types III forest fire stations. Space, aviation, and ground monitoring of the fire hazardous situation in the forests is carried out, in addition, a set of measures is being taken for the fire-prevention arrangement of forests.
